GA 2002: NCGUB Briefing Paper

Description: 

Briefing paper on the current political and human rights situation in Burma 2002. For the 57th Session of the UN General Assembly?s resolution on ?the human rights situation in Myanmar [Burma]?. Prepared by the Burma UN Service Office of the National Coalition Government of the Union of Burma, 2 October 2002. Contents: Summary; Suggested Language for the Resolution ; The Move Towards a Genuine and Substantive Dialogue ; Political Prisoners and Political Activities ; The Judicial System and Unjust Laws and Orders ; The National Convention; Continued violations of human rights and widespread discriminatory practices against ethnic and religious minorities; Forced displacement; Women; Children; Refugees and IDPs; Landmines; Forced Labor; Restrictions on religious freedom ; Humanitarian concerns; The Economic situation; Appendix I: Aide Memoire ? Impact of Armed Conflict on the Children of Burma.
